Conservation Science

We study ecosystems and the plants and animals who thrive or flounder there. We focus on the biology, ecology, human interaction, and use of natural resources, with an eye toward informing how natural resource managers make decisions that preserve habitat, protect endangered species, and manage whole ecosystems.
